Показать сообщение отдельно
Старый 20.10.2015, 02:37   #5
Пользователь
 
Регистрация: 29.09.2010
Сообщений: 34
Сказал Спасибо: 18
Имеет 1 спасибку в 1 сообщении
controller пока неопределено
По умолчанию

ничего не понятно все равно
Код:
procedure test;stdcall;
var
lpStartAddress:Pointer;
begin
lpStartAddress:=GetProcAddress(GetModuleHandle('dsetup.dll'), '??0Cdsetup@@QAE@XZ');
//lpStartAddress:=GetProcAddress(GetModuleHandle('dsetup.dll'), '??0Cdsetup@@QAE@XZ')+$8190; это не работает делфи ругается
ShowMessage (IntToStr(Integer(lpStartAddress)));
end;
 в итоге тут я получаю 0
Это правильно я сделал? просто пока я получаю 0, нет смысла дальше работать

Последний раз редактировалось controller, 20.10.2015 в 04:26.
controller вне форума   Ответить с цитированием